A compact precision stylus with a clear disc tip — you see through the disc to exactly where the line will land, which is the difference between guessing and drawing accurately.
What it does:
Clear precision disc tip
No battery or pairing required
Compact body with a clip
Blue or grey
Where it fits: maths working, diagrams, annotation and drawing tasks where a rubber tip is too blunt. The disc tip is a replaceable part — spares are available.

Replacement clear disc tips for the Adonit Mini 4, Pro 3 and Pro 4. The disc is the part that wears — it's what lets you see exactly where the line lands, and a worn one skips and drags.
What's included: two replacement disc tips.
Worth stocking for a class set. Disc tips are the most-replaced part on a precision stylus, and a worn tip is the usual reason a student says the stylus has stopped working.
